Bagaimana untuk menyimpan data tersuai dalam HTML sebagai data peribadi untuk halaman atau aplikasi?

PHPz
Lepaskan: 2023-09-12 14:25:02
ke hadapan
684 orang telah melayarinya

Bagaimana untuk menyimpan data tersuai dalam HTML sebagai data peribadi untuk halaman atau aplikasi?

Atribut tersuai ialah atribut yang direka khas yang tidak termasuk dalam atribut HTML5 standard. Mereka membenarkan kami menyesuaikan teg HTML dengan menambahkan data kami sendiri.

Atribut tersuai ialah sebarang atribut yang bermula dengan data-. Kami boleh membenamkan atribut tersuai pada semua komponen HTML menggunakan atribut data-*.

Sintaks: HTML

Dalam HTML, sintaks atribut data-* agak mudah. Setiap elemen bermula dengan data- ialah atribut data-*.

<sample_data>
   id = “sample”
   data-index = 1
   data-row = 23
   data-column = 44
</sample_data>
Salin selepas log masuk

Syntax: diakses menggunakan JavaScript

Mengakses atribut data ini menggunakan JavaScript juga agak mudah. Kita boleh menggunakan getAttribute() dengan nama HTML penuhnya, yang boleh dibaca menggunakan atribut set data.

rreeee

Sintaks: diakses menggunakan CSS

Gunakan fungsi attr() CSS untuk mengakses data.

rreeee

Berikut adalah contoh...

Terjemahan bahasa Cina bagi

Contoh

ialah:

Contoh

Dalam contoh di bawah, kami menggunakan JavaScript untuk membaca nilai harta.

const article = document.querySelector('#sample');
sample_data.dataset.index;
sample_data.dataset.row;
sample_data.dataset.column;
Salin selepas log masuk

Output

Apabila melaksanakan skrip di atas, ia akan menghasilkan output senarai nama yang mengandungi beberapa data.

Apabila anda cuba mengklik mana-mana nama, fungsi mendapat data dan memaparkan kotak amaran yang menunjukkan data tersuai yang kami gunakan.

Atas ialah kandungan terperinci Bagaimana untuk menyimpan data tersuai dalam HTML sebagai data peribadi untuk halaman atau aplikasi?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

sumber:tutorialspoint.com
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an
Tentang kita Penafian Sitemap
Laman web PHP Cina:Latihan PHP dalam talian kebajikan awam,Bantu pelajar PHP berkembang dengan cepat!